Lavender (Lavandula angustifolia)

Lavender has been used in traditional herbal wellness practices as a calming and aromatic flowering herb. It is commonly enjoyed to support the body’s natural relaxation response, with a focus on emotional balance, nervous system comfort, and restful daily routines. Many people include lavender during times of occasional stress, tension, or mental fatigue, as its naturally occurring aromatic plant compounds help promote gentle calm, ease, and overall wellbeing.

How to Make Lavender Tea

Measure: Add 1–2 teaspoons of dried lavender per 8–10 oz (1 cup) of hot water.
Steep: Pour hot water over the flowers and steep for 5–10 minutes (shorter steeping keeps the flavor gentle).
Strain: Strain into your favorite cup.
Enjoy: Drink warm, preferably in the evening or during quiet moments.

Tip: Lavender pairs beautifully with lemon balm, chamomile, or rose petals for a softer, more balanced cup.
